Refrigerator Repair in Framingham MA Cooling Issues Leaks and Ice Maker Problems
If your refrigerator is not cooling, leaking water, building frost, or cycling too often, the issue can involve airflow, sensors, fans, or sealed-system performance. Symptom → meaning → what we do: if cooling is inconsistent, it often points to airflow or temperature-control problems, so we test airflow and temperature readings before recommending parts. We then complete the repair with OEM or manufacturer-approved parts when applicable and recheck temperatures for stable cooling.

Dishwasher Repair in Framingham MA Drainage Cleaning Results and Noise Troubles
A dishwasher that leaves residue, won’t drain, smells bad, or makes unusual sounds can point to clogs, pump issues, spray arm problems, or a door seal concern. Symptom → meaning → what we do: if the unit won’t drain, it may indicate a blocked drain path or a weak pump, so we inspect filters, the drain route, and key components before choosing the best fix. After service, we confirm proper drainage and cleaning performance.

Washing Machine Repair in Framingham MA Leaks Spin Problems and Drain Errors
When a washer won’t spin, won’t drain, leaks onto the floor, or shakes heavily, the cause is often a worn component, a drainage restriction, or a control issue. Symptom → meaning → what we do: if the washer won’t drain, it can signal a pump or drain-path problem, so we inspect the drain system and test operation before recommending a repair. If the unit shakes hard, we look at balance, suspension, and drive-related components.

Dryer Repair in Framingham MA No Heat Long Dry Times and Overheating Concerns
If your dryer is not heating, takes too long to dry, or overheats, airflow and heating components are often involved. Symptom → meaning → what we do: long dry times may point to restricted airflow, so we check venting and internal airflow first, then test heating and safety components based on the model. Stove Repair in Framingham MA Burners Ignition and Heat Control Issues
Stove issues like burners not igniting, uneven heat, or controls not responding can interrupt cooking and raise safety concerns. Symptom → meaning → what we do: if a burner won’t ignite, it may involve ignition parts or electrical switching, so we test the ignition and control path before replacing anything. For uneven heat, we check the burner, connections, and temperature behavior to restore steady cooking performance.

Oven Repair in Framingham MA Temperature Swings No Heat and Uneven Baking
If an oven won’t heat, bakes unevenly, or has temperature swings, the issue may involve sensors, heating elements, ignition parts, or controls. Symptom → meaning → what we do: if temperature is unstable, it can signal a sensor or control problem, so we test temperature feedback and heating behavior before recommending the fix. After repair, we confirm normal heating and more even results.
